Description
This issue was addressed with additional entitlement checks. This issue is fixed in macOS Tahoe 26. An app with root privileges may be able to access private information.

Executive Summary

This vulnerability involves an app with root privileges potentially being able to access private information due to insufficient entitlement checks. It was addressed by adding additional entitlement checks in macOS Tahoe 26.

Impact Analysis

If exploited, this vulnerability could allow an app running with root privileges to access private information that it should not have access to, potentially leading to unauthorized data exposure.

Mitigation Strategies

Update your system to macOS Tahoe 26 or later, where this issue has been fixed with additional entitlement checks to prevent apps with root privileges from accessing private information.
